The Bachelor of Science in Communication Sciences and Disorders at Illinois State University is a distinguished program that equips students with the essential skills and knowledge required for a successful career in communication sciences. This program stands out as a prime choice for those interested in understanding the intricacies of human communication, covering vital areas such as speech-language pathology, audiology, and hearing sciences.
The curriculum is meticulously designed to provide a comprehensive education in the field. Students will engage in core courses that delve into normal communication processes, speech and language development, and the impact of communication disorders. Advanced courses further explore diagnostic and therapeutic techniques, equipping students with practical skills to assess and treat various communication challenges. The program emphasizes evidence-based practice and includes hands-on experiences through supervised clinical placements, ensuring that graduates are well-prepared for the demands of the industry.

To be eligible for the Bachelor of Science in Communication Sciences and Disorders program, applicants must satisfy certain requirements. A high school diploma or equivalent is necessary, along with a minimum GPA of 3.0. Prospective students are also required to submit an academic letter of recommendation, a well-crafted personal statement, and their academic transcripts. Additionally, non-native English speakers must demonstrate proficiency through standardized tests such as TOEFL or IELTS.
The program duration is approximately 48 months, and students can expect to invest around USD 26,843 annually for tuition.
